Step 1: Start With Keyword Research

Before writing any article, you must know what people are searching for.

This process is called keyword research for bloggers.

Instead of guessing topics, research:

  • What questions people ask

  • What problems they want solved

  • Which keywords have low competition

For example:
Instead of writing “Blogging Tips,” write “Blogging Tips for College Students.”

Specific keywords are easier to rank.

Good SEO always starts before writing.

Step 3: Use On Page SEO for Blogs

On-page optimization means improving things inside your article.

Important elements include:

1. Title Optimization

Add your main keyword naturally in the title.

2. Headings (H2, H3)

Use subheadings to organize content.

3. URL Structure

Keep URL short and clear.
Example:
yourwebsite.com/seo-for-bloggers

4. Meta Description

Write a short summary that encourages clicks.

On page SEO for blogs helps search engines understand your content structure clearly.


Step 4: Optimize Images

Images make content interesting. But they also need optimization.

Simple image SEO tips:

  • Compress images for fast loading

  • Add alt text

  • Use descriptive file names

Fast websites rank better.

Speed is part of technical SEO basics.

Step 6: Internal Linking Strategy

Internal links connect one article to another inside your website.

Benefits:

  • Helps Google crawl your site

  • Increases page time

  • Distributes authority

For example:
If you write about blogging, link to related articles like “Blogging Mistakes” or “Best Blogging Platforms.”

Smart internal linking helps improve blog traffic naturally.

Step 8: Build Backlinks Slowly

Backlinks are links from other websites to yours.

They act like votes of trust.

Ways to get backlinks:

  • Guest posting

  • Writing high-quality content

  • Sharing on social media

  • Networking with bloggers

Backlinks strengthen your SEO authority.

But avoid buying spam links. That can damage rankings.
